**The Unforeseen Turn in AI Evolution**

In the ever-evolving landscape of artificial intelligence (AI), the technology has once again pushed boundaries, but this time in a direction not entirely anticipated. The latest buzz in the tech world revolves around a new platform called Rent a Human, where AI agents quite literally employ human beings to perform various tasks. This development brings to light a thought-provoking question: if you’re not actively using AI in your day-to-day life, could it soon start using you?

The paradigm shift we are witnessing is unlike anything before. Just a few years ago, AI primarily served as a productivity tool—one designed to make human tasks simpler, faster, and more efficient. But now, the tables are turning. With AI agents actively hiring humans to perform tasks like attending meetings and picking up packages, we are entering a brave new world where AI takes on an employer role.

**Stepping Into a New Reality**

Imagine receiving a notification on your phone: an AI agent has assigned you a task to attend a meeting on its behalf or to deliver a package across town. Once the job is completed, payment is processed directly into your account. This is not a futuristic dream but the reality facilitated by Rent a Human, a platform that attracted an astounding 70,000 users within just two days. It seems that the gig economy is getting a high-tech upgrade, where the boss might not even be human.

**The Lessons in Adaptation and Opportunity**

There’s an imperative learning moment in the midst of all this technological upheaval. The integration of AI into our daily lives is not just inevitable; it’s becoming intensely personal. As AI continues to spread its influence across various sectors, its interaction with human labor opens both opportunities and challenges.

Opportunities, because there’s a brand-new job market emerging—one where humans and AI collaborate in a way that optimizes efficiency and productivity. With 70,000 people signing up for this platform in a span of two days, it’s evident that many are eager to explore this new frontier. For digital nomads, freelancers, and gig workers, this might be a golden opportunity to further diversify their income streams by taking on tasks from an AI employer.

Yet challenges also lie ahead. For one, this shift raises questions about job security, ethical considerations, and the evolution of employment laws. As humans become interwoven with AI systems, the need for new rules and precautions becomes pressing. There is also the inherent challenge of ensuring fair compensation and working conditions in a landscape where your boss isn’t a human being, but an algorithm.
